Jacksonville tops SC Upstate 79-69
Travis Cohn scored 18 points to lead Jacksonville to a 79-69 win over South Carolina Upstate on Monday night. Cohn added seven rebounds and Ayron Hardy chipped in 15 points and five assists for the Dolphins (4-8, 3-1 Atlantic Sun Conference).

Breaking News From New York Prosecutor wants Madoff jailed without bail
A prosecutor on Monday asked that Bernard Madoff be jailed pending trial, saying the disgraced financier violated an agreement with the court by mailing watches, jewelry, cufflinks and mittens worth more than $1 million to relatives and friends. Breaking News From North Carolina Navy beats Elon 66-62
Adam Teague scored four of his 11 points during an 8-0 run in the game's final 1:33 to help Navy to a 66-62 comeback win against Elon on Monday night. Breaking News From Florida Florida State rallied to beat Texas A&M 60-53
Tanae Davis-Cain scored 11 of her 13 points in the second half and Florida State rallied to upset No. 3 Texas A&M 60-53 on Monday night.
